一、硬件资源选择策略
计算资源的选择直接影响服务器性能表现。建议根据工作负载类型进行配置:
- CPU核数选择:计算密集型应用建议配置高频多核处理器,I/O密集型应用侧重缓存优化
- 内存分配原则:物理内存建议保留20%冗余空间,避免swap内存交换影响性能
- 存储方案优化:高并发场景优先选择SSD存储,数据库应用推荐RAID10阵列配置
二、操作系统调整优化
通过系统级调优可提升10%-30%的性能表现,重点调整方向包括:
- 调整内核参数:优化TCP连接数、文件句柄限制和虚拟内存分配策略
- 选择高效文件系统:XFS/ext4适合常规应用,Btrfs适用于需要快照的场景
- 禁用非必要服务:关闭未使用的系统服务以释放资源
三、网络配置优化实践
网络性能优化需考虑多维度参数配置:
- 带宽分配:基准带宽建议按峰值流量的1.5倍配置
- 连接管理:优化TCP窗口大小和TIME_WAIT连接回收策略
- 负载均衡:采用LVS或云平台原生负载均衡组件实现流量分发
四、安全策略实施要点
安全配置应与性能优化形成平衡:
- 修改默认SSH端口并启用密钥认证
- 配置基于角色的访问控制(RBAC)策略
- 启用实时入侵检测系统(IDS)
五、监控与维护机制
建立完善的监控体系可确保持续优化:
- 部署Prometheus+Grafana监控套件
- 设置CPU&内存使用率告警阈值(建议80%)
- 定期执行性能基准测试和日志分析
云服务器优化是涵盖硬件选型、系统调优、网络配置、安全加固和持续监控的体系化工程。通过科学配置CPU与内存配比(建议4:8或8:16)、合理选择存储方案、优化内核参数,结合实时监控机制,可使服务器资源利用率提升25%-40%。建议每季度进行配置审计,确保优化策略持续有效。